How to Get a Key Copy For Your Car Or Truck
Most hardware stores will cut standard keys, some will even program spare keys in the event that you already have one. However, very few hardware stores have the equipment to duplicate a more recent key fob using a transponder.
It is recommended to visit locksmiths who specialize in automotive, home and office locks. You can also try an auto dealership, however they will typically be more expensive.
Key Clone
Key Cloning is the process of creating an exact replica of your original key. It copies the electronic code from the transponder of your key and transfers it to another chip in a brand new blank key. When you insert the key cloned into the ignition your vehicle will be able to detect the information stored on the transponder and recognize it as a genuine key. This is a useful anti-theft measure that prevents your vehicle from being used by illegal people.
Cloning is possible on the majority of modern keys, but some keys are not immune to this. ID33 rolling transponders that are found on BMW keys, are clone-proof at moment, as are Ford and Toyota 80 bit transponders. These can only be cloned with special equipment that sniffs out the data contained on the keys.
Other kinds of clonable devices can be programmed with a predetermined value, or even with no value at all. This is a decision made by the manufacturer. The type of clonable transponder can be determined by looking at the part number on the blank head of the key or the shape of the plastic head.
Cloning is not difficult however, it requires the proper equipment. Locksmiths have access to these tools and provide cloning services to their clients. The equipment is available to criminals who are seeking to steal cars or other vehicles.

Key Fobs
Key Fobs, which are small electronic tokens, can be programmed and used to gain access to physical objects such as cars, doors, apartments, and more. They communicate via radio frequencies with a reader that is connected to an access system, which then allows the user to enter. These key fobs are often referred to as "fob keys", "key cards" or "proximity key fobs."
They are less cumbersome to use and more secure than physical key fobs. The key fob's code is unique and difficult to duplicate or copy. This feature can also stop unauthorized entries by denying access to people who don't possess the correct fob, or have one that's been compromised.
A key fob system offers more security than a standard lock, or even a smart door lock because it is impossible for anyone to enter using the wrong key or get in with the correct key without notifying you. A key fob can also report who entered and when, which is helpful for business owners who want to know who is going in and out.
Modern key fobs operate using radio frequency identification (RFID), which is similar to the barcode systems used in retail stores. They are equipped with microchips that store information and send it to readers when they're activated by the correct codes. These readers could include things like door readers for apartments proximity locks, as well as other keyless entry devices.

Transponder Keys
Transponder keys, sometimes referred to as chip keys, are fitted with a small microchip that transmits an unintentional radio signal that has a unique digital serial number. This is used to identify the key and permit it to start the vehicle. They are more secure than standard metal keys and provide increased security against theft.
The microchip inside a transponder has been programmed for a specific vehicle. When the key is inserted into the ignition it sends an indication to the vehicle's receiver and it will then check to see if the serial number matches up. If it does, the engine will begin to run. This prevents unauthorised users from starting the car using the incorrect key or a poorly programmed key.
Transponder keys can't be duplicated using key copy machines. Instead, they need to be manually programmed by locksmiths.
